'''St. Jacinta Marto''', together with her brother Francisco and cousin Lucia, was one of the three children to whom the [[Blessed Virgin Mary]] reportedly appeared in Fátima, Portugal, in 1917<ref name="catholic.org">www.catholic.org</ref>.  


Known for her deep devotion and love for the Immaculate Heart of Mary, Jacinta's life was marked by sacrifice, prayer, and suffering, particularly during the Spanish Flu epidemic<ref name="ewtn.com">www.ewtn.com</ref>.
